Above ground pool repair services typically cover a range of tasks aimed at restoring and maintaining the integrity of the pool structure. This can include fixing leaks, replacing damaged or worn-out panels, repairing or replacing the pool’s liner, and addressing issues with the framing or supports. In some cases, repairs may extend to addressing equipment problems such as filters, pumps, or plumbing components that are integral to the pool’s operation. Understanding the specific scope of work needed is essential for property owners to ensure the repair process addresses all underlying issues and maintains the safety and functionality of the pool.
